The hotel environment is great, with a lovely decor that creates a good atmosphere. You can even try on Hanfu, though I didn't personally. The staff are very attentive and resolve any issues promptly. Housekeeping cleaned my room daily, and I had a very pleasant stay for all five nights.
As I was traveling solo, I was a bit concerned about safety. However, the door is very sturdy and has an alarm that goes off at the slightest irregularity. Plus, I could see the door from my bed, and it was close enough to the desk that I could prop a chair against it, which made me feel very secure. The room wasn't huge, but the layout was excellent, and the wet and dry areas were well-separated. Most importantly, I've never stayed in a room with so many tables – it was fantastic! There was always plenty of space for my belongings. The view outside the room was also nice. Although I was told there was a KTV nearby, I didn't experience any noise during my five-night stay.
The hotel is very close to Xinghai Square, just a few minutes' walk, so I could go see the ocean and feed the pigeons whenever I wanted. The only minor drawback is that it's nearly a 20-minute walk to the nearest subway station, and about a 5-6 minute walk to the closest bus stop. However, taxis are very convenient here; I usually got a Didi ride within ten seconds. All in all, I had a very comfortable stay and highly recommend it!

GGuest UserThe hotel boasts a fantastic location. Right outside, you'll find a scenic viewing platform, conveniently situated between Gates 3 and 4. For just 20 RMB, you can enjoy unlimited rides on the shuttle bus all day, which conveniently connects all gates from 1 to 7. Gates 3 and 7 offer water activities, while Gate 6 features a charming beach dotted with pink tents. If you're looking for dining options, Gates 1 and 2 have a wider selection. In the evenings, Gate 3 also hosts vibrant stage performances. The hotel rooms are generously sized. Photos 1, 7, and 10-13 below were all taken from the hotel balcony, showcasing the stunning views. In the evenings, you can clearly hear the lively buzz from the Gate 3 performances, and at 9:30 PM, you're treated to the spectacular fireworks display from Discoveryland. It's also a perfect spot to catch the sunrise in the morning.
